加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.51jishu.com.cn/)- CDN、大数据、低代码、行业智能、边缘计算!
当前位置: 首页 > 站长学院 > Asp教程 > 正文

Python透视ASP:安全加固与高效调试指南

发布时间:2026-03-06 16:09:06 所属栏目:Asp教程 来源:DaWei
导读:  Python作为一种广泛应用的编程语言,在Web开发中经常与ASP(Active Server Pages)进行交互,尤其是在一些遗留系统或混合架构中。然而,这种结合可能带来一定的安全风险和调试挑战,因此需要采取有效的措施来确保

  Python作为一种广泛应用的编程语言,在Web开发中经常与ASP(Active Server Pages)进行交互,尤其是在一些遗留系统或混合架构中。然而,这种结合可能带来一定的安全风险和调试挑战,因此需要采取有效的措施来确保系统的安全性与稳定性。


  在安全加固方面,首要任务是防范常见的Web攻击,如SQL注入、跨站脚本攻击(XSS)等。Python代码在处理用户输入时应严格验证和过滤数据,避免直接拼接查询语句,推荐使用参数化查询或ORM框架来降低风险。


  对ASP与Python之间的通信接口进行加密也是必要的。通过HTTPS协议传输数据,可以有效防止中间人攻击,同时确保敏感信息不会被窃取。对于关键操作,还可以引入身份验证机制,如JWT或OAuth,以增强访问控制。


  调试过程中,日志记录是提高效率的重要手段。Python应用应配置详细的日志系统,记录请求参数、错误信息及执行流程,便于快速定位问题。同时,合理利用调试工具,如pdb或IDE内置的调试器,能够显著提升排查速度。


AI生成的趋势图,仅供参考

  在性能优化方面,需关注Python与ASP之间数据交换的效率。避免频繁的跨语言调用,尽量减少不必要的数据序列化和反序列化操作。合理使用缓存机制,也能有效降低系统负载,提升响应速度。


  定期进行安全审计和代码审查,有助于发现潜在漏洞并及时修复。同时,保持对最新安全威胁的了解,更新依赖库和框架,是保障系统长期稳定运行的关键。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章